HTML
- Basic HTML structure
- HTML starter file
- Elements, Tags and Attributes
- Empty and container elements
- Nesting: parents and children
- HTML sectional elements
- Formatting text in HTML
CSS
- Types of CSS
- How to write CSS
- CSS selectors
- CSS box model: width, height, padding, margins, borders
- CSS units: pixels (px), percentage (%), em, rem.
- Block-level and Inline elements
- CSS type properties
- Adaptive Sizing and Typography
- The width and max-width properties
- em, rem and percentage CSS units
- Viewport and Media Queries